How science guides common facial therapy methods

Understanding the scientific basis of various techniques enhances the effectiveness of any Facials Spa experience. Common modalities, like chemical peels, entail applying acids to exfoliate the outermost skin layers, fostering cellular turnover and exposing brighter, smoother skin. This process can significantly enhance texture and decrease the appearance of wrinkles, a key aspect of many anti-aging facials offered at a Facials Spa.

Dermaplaning physically removes dead skin cells and vellus hair using a specialized blade, leading to immediate skin rejuvenation and improved product absorption. Microdermabrasion uses fine crystals or a diamond-tipped wand to gently abrade the skin, addressing issues like uneven tone and mild acne scarring. Light therapy, another common Facials Spa treatment, uses specific wavelengths to target concerns such as inflammation or promote collagen production for youthful skin facials, supplying a non-invasive approach to improving skin health.

Your handbook to the historical development of facial skincare treatments

The search of radiant skin dates millennia, evolving from ancient rituals to today's advanced Facials Spa treatments. Early civilizations employed natural elements like herbs, oils, and mud masks for cleansing and beautification, recognizing the importance of facial care.

From the Egyptians' employment of exfoliation and aromatic oils to the Romans' elaborate bathhouse routines including facial massage and botanical extracts, the foundations of modern Facials Spa practices were laid. The Renaissance saw the rise of intricate cosmetic recipes, while the 20th century ushered scientific advancements in skincare, leading to specialized products and the formal establishment of the modern Facials Spa concept, offering sophisticated aesthetic solutions.

Understanding the differences in spa and med spa facial treatments

Grasping the key differences between a traditional Facials Spa and a Med Spa is essential for selecting the appropriate facial rejuvenation. A standard Facials Spa focuses on relaxation facials and general skin care facials, offering aesthetic treatments like deep cleansing facials, hydrating facials, and refreshing facials, all performed by licensed estheticians. These luxury facials spa experiences focus overall wellness, often integrating massage and facials spa services within a calm environment, ideal for a day spa facials experience.

Conversely, an aesthetic spa or Med Spa extends beyond typical facial offers, providing medical-grade facial treatments under physician supervision. While a Facials Spa offers wide-ranging spa facial services, a Med Spa delves into more intensive facial therapy spa options, utilizing advanced technologies such such as laser treatments, injectables like Botox, and Rezenerate Nanofacial. These clinical settings provide solutions for specific concerns, offering a more aggressive method to facial rejuvenation spa needs than a conventional beauty spa facials establishment. Both seek for improved skin, but their methodologies and the depth of their interventions vary significantly.
